  • Page 7: Notes On Radio Operation

    MVA003 User manual and device specification Notes on radio operation Transmission range The radio transmission range is limited by both the distance between transmitter and receiver, and by interference. Indoors, building materials play an important role. Major reflections and signal losses are due to metallic parts, such as reinforcements in walls and metallized foils, which are used on thermal insulation products.

  • Page 9: Example Of A Radio Protocol

    MVA003 User manual and device specification Summer Mode (DB_1.Bit_3) When the actuator receives the status message „Summer mode ON“ from the external radio master, then the valve opens and the transmit/receive interval is increased from 10 minutes to 8 hours. It is possible to wake up the iTRV through 1 x pressing the push button.

  • Page 15: User Control Description

    MVA003 User manual and device specification User Control description 7.1 Installation with Manual Pairing Pairing / Teach-In, Mounting position and OFF Set the EnOcean controller or gateway to pairing mode. Then take the MVA003 from its packing and press the button at least twice within 2 seconds. MVA003 confirms successful pairing by a single flash of the red LED.
  • Page 16: Installation With Remote Commissioning

    MVA003 User manual and device specification 7.2 Installation with Remote Commissioning Attaching the unit to the radiator valve Take the MVA003 from its packing. It should be in mounting position, e.g. the plunger is moved fully inwards so that the unit can be attached to a radiator valve without force. Remove any existing thermostatic head that may be affixed to the radiator valve.
